Re: Jose's Landfall and Former Tropical Depression 10

Difficult to locate a possible LLCC with this one, especially as it may not even be there. I would guess looking at the visible imagery, that if there is a centre it is probably somewhere around 21.1'N 74.9'W. However, the low level cloudlines dont give much support to there being a LLCC in this region, so it may be just at the mid-levels at the moment.

Also noticed that our friend 97L has a LLCC in the vicinty of 17.5'N 36.8'W. However, the convection is removed to the east of this centre. Certainly something else worth watching though
